A friend of mine has been doing visa runs for years. Eight or so months ago he was told in no uncertain terms to NOT return to Phnom Penh again. That was to be his last visa from there. He was quite upset and seriously considered leaving Thailand. He changed to Laos visa runs and since then is now going back to Phnom Penh. Conditions are ALWAYS subject to change and the only thing consistent is the inconsistency. Good luck to him and those like him.

Shock and surprise ?? Since the government has been planning to do this for several years I don't know why anyone should be surprised. There will be several groups hurt by this. The backpacker school teachers will suffer the most. The many mini van companies who specialize in border runs and last but not least the Camdodian government will not be collecting so many visa fees.

Kind of like the people who are very upset because they "own" property through bogus companies. :o
